Do you remember hearing about a game called Killer Freaks From Outer Space? If so, you might be wondering what happened to that previously-announced Ubisoft project. The answer to that question is ZombiU, a game that was born out of the above-mentioned title’s ashes. A Wii U exclusive, it was unveiled today at Ubisoft‘s E3 press conference, although details were scarce at that time.

Now that we’re about an hour removed from the company’s grand stage-based spectacle, we have some new information to pass on to you, thanks to a press release that was sent out to us.

Here’s the gist:

ZombiU is a survival horror/first-person shooter mixture from Ubisoft Montpellier (From Dust, Beyond Good & Evil.) It tells the tale of a fictional version of present-day London, where a virus has turned most of the city’s inhabitants into flesh-craving monsters. The resulting threat of a grisly death has mankind’s remnants fighting against the zombie onslaught, with players trying to keep individual survivors alive for as long as they can. If one dies, it’s on to the next body, forcing them to go back and pick up important items if need be.

The Wii U’s controller will become each gamer’s “ultimate survival kit,” which is referred to as the Bug Out Bag and includes everything they’ll need to survive. Additionally, the controller can also be used to create a connection between players and the game’s world.

Last but not least, ZombiU will offer a competitive multiplayer mode where one player gets to act as a zombie master. They will get to spawn freaks, with the hope that their undead army will overpower the opposing second player.

UBISOFT®’S INFECTIOUS ZOMBIUTM COMING EXCLUSIVELY TO NINTENDO WII UTM

Survival-Horror Game Showcases Wii UTM Controller and Delivers Intense and Terrifying New Gaming Experience

MONTRÉAL — June 4, 2012 — Today, at the Electronic Entertainment Expo (E3), Ubisoft challenged gamers to find out how long they can survive in the dilapidated, infected world of ZombiU – a new survival-horror game that will be released exclusively for Nintendo’s Wii UTM. ZombiU headlines a group of seven titles from Ubisoft that will be available for the Nintendo Wii UTM.

Developed by Ubisoft Montpellier, the studio behind critically acclaimed titles like From DustTM, Beyond Good & Evil and, Ghost Recon Advanced Warfighter, ZombiU puts players in the middle of London circa 2012, where an outbreak has infected the population, destroying their humanity and turning them into mindless monsters preying on the flesh of the few remaining survivors. This fear-fueled first-person shooter invites takes all the horror, chaos and tension found in the best of the horror genre and adds original interactive elements, including a unique death mechanic that puts players in the body of a different survivor each time they die, allowing them to track and take down their old, infected characters, recover their equipment and see if they can stay alive just a little bit longer this time.

ZombiU showcases the innovative features of the Nintendo Wii UTM Controller and creates new game experiences not possible on other consoles. The Nintendo Wii UTM Controller serves as the player’s ultimate survival kit, called the “Bug Out Bag.” The Bug Out Bag is a backpack containing all the maps, tools, weapons and supplies that players can scavenge from the limited resources available in the devastated cityscape. ZombiU also will use the Nintendo Wii UTM Controller’s touch screen, gyroscope and camera to create a tactile connection between gamers and the in-game world. Finally, ZombiU features a distinctive multiplayer adversarial mode that allows one player to take on the role of “Zombie Master,” spawning and controlling enemies from a top-down view on the Nintendo Wii UTM Controller while the second player fights for survival on the big screen in first-person shooter view with a Wii wireless classic controller.
